Goldmine Grading Scale:( All records and CDs are both Audibly and visually graded).

Sealed/Mint-Factory sealed like you would buy new in a record shop.

Mint Minus(M-)  Absolutely perfect in every way, few plays if any.

Near Mint (NM)  Played more times than a Mint Minus LP. A nearly perfect record. Record shows no obvious signs of wear. Quite acceptable condition for most collectors.

Very Good Plus (VG+) - record will show some signs that it was played and otherwise handled by a previous owner who took good care of it.  May have slight signs of wear and slight scuffs and scratches but no skips. Might have slight cover damage.

Very Good (VG) - A record similar to VG+ where the defects are more pronounced.  Surface noise and scratches will be evident, but will not overpower the music. Cover damage/wear.

Good (G) - A record that will play through without skipping, but has significant surface noise, scratches, and visible groove wear.

Fair (F) - Grade between poor and good, obviously.  Very heavy damage, possible skips, though the record should still play. An LP of interest only if an LP is very rare.

Poor (P) - A record with heavy damage, probably will skip, and is the worst grade.
